A speaker or writer uses your to indicate that something belongs or relates to the person or people that they are talking or writing to Emma, i trust your opinion a great deal I left all of your. Your is a possessive adjective that means belonging to you (e.g., your dog is well behaved)

You're is a contraction of you are.
